Qualcomm Snapdragon 6 Gen 1 vs Qualcomm Snapdragon 7s Gen 2

The Qualcomm Snapdragon 6 Gen 1 (SM6450) mobile platform was designed for Android-based smartphones and tablets and was launched in September 2022. The SoC (system-on-a-chip) is in the entry-level class and is based on ARM's v9 architecture.

The cryo CPU of the Snapdragon 6 Gen 1 is based on four ARM Cortex-A78 performance cores with clock frequencies of up to 2.2 GHz and an efficiency cluster consisting of four Cortex-A55 cores with a clock frequency of 1.8 GHz.

An Adreno 710 is used as the integrated graphics unit. The Soc also integrates a Spectra ISP (200 MP photo), a dual-channel 16-bit LPDDR 2750 MHz memory controller, an X62 5G modem (max 2.9 GBit/s download, 1.6 Gbit/s upload), a Fastconnect 6700 Wi-Fi 6E / Bluetooth 5.2 modem and Hexagon.

The SoC is manufactured in the modern 4 nm process at Samsung.

The Qualcomm Snapdragon 7s Gen 2 (SM7435-AB) is an ARMv9-A-based SoC for tablets and smartphones in the upper mid-range segment.

The Qualcomm Snapdragon 7s Gen 2 integrates a total of 8 cores divided into two clusters. The ARM Cortex-A78 cluster for high performance offers four cores with up to 2.4 GHz. The remaining 4 cores are based on the more energy-efficient A55 architecture and can be clocked at up to 1.95 GHz. All cores can run simultaneously or just a single cluster.

The SoC is similar to the Snapdragon 7 Gen 1 which offers a slightly lower clocked efficiency cluster and a different named GPU. The similar named Snapdragon 7+ Gen 2 is clearly faster with newer CPU cores. Although the naming suggest it, there was no Snapdragon 7s Gen 1.

LPDDR5 RAM is supported, with a frequency of up to 6,400 MHz.

The Snapdragon X62 5G modem is used as the modem. It supports a range of SA and NSA 5G mmWave and sub-6 GHz frequencies as well as Dynamic Spectrum Sharing (DSS). The X62 can achieve a maximum downlink speed of up to 2.9 Gbit/s in 5G networks.

The Adreno 710 forms the graphics subsystem. The GPU is capable of driving FHD+ displays at up to 144 Hz.

The Qualcomm Snapdragon 7s Gen 2 is manufactured using the modern 4nm EUV process.
